Understanding Motivation

Motivation is the driving force behind why people act the way they do. It is the reason why you get up in the morning, go to work, and pursue your goals. Understanding motivation is crucial to achieving success in both personal and professional endeavors.

Intrinsic vs. Extrinsic Motivation

Motivation can be divided into two categories: intrinsic and extrinsic. Intrinsic motivation comes from within and is driven by personal satisfaction, enjoyment, or fulfillment. Extrinsic motivation, on the other hand, comes from external factors such as rewards, recognition, or pressure.

While both types of motivation can be effective in driving behavior, intrinsic motivation is generally considered to be more sustainable and fulfilling. When you are intrinsically motivated, you are more likely to enjoy the process of pursuing your goals and feel a sense of personal satisfaction when you achieve them.

The Psychology of Motivation

Motivation is a complex psychological process that is influenced by a variety of factors, including values, beliefs, and self-regulation. Understanding these factors can help you better understand why you are motivated to pursue certain goals and how to stay motivated over the long term.

Identified motivation is a type of motivation that is driven by a sense of personal identity and values. When you are motivated by identified motivation, you are more likely to stay committed to your goals because they align with your personal values and sense of identity.

Motivation and Goal Theory

Goal theory suggests that motivation is driven by the desire to achieve specific goals. When you set clear, achievable goals, you are more likely to feel motivated to pursue them. However, it is important to set goals that are challenging but achievable to maintain motivation over the long term.

The Role of a Motivational Coach

Motivational coaching is a process that involves helping individuals identify their goals, overcome obstacles, and reach their full potential. A motivational coach acts as a facilitator, igniting a spark within the client that fuels their journey of self-improvement and realization.

Defining the Coaching Relationship

Coaching is a collaborative partnership between the coach and the client, where the coach provides guidance, support, and accountability to help the client achieve their goals. The International Coach Federation (ICF) defines coaching as "partnering with clients in a thought-provoking and creative process that inspires them to maximize their personal and professional potential."

Benefits of Motivational Coaching

Motivational coaching has numerous benefits, including:

  • Increased self-awareness and self-confidence
  • Improved goal-setting and goal-achievement skills
  • Enhanced communication and interpersonal skills
  • Greater clarity and focus
  • Increased motivation and accountability

Through motivational coaching, clients are able to identify their strengths and weaknesses, set achievable goals, and develop the skills and strategies necessary to achieve those goals.

ICF and Coaching Standards

The ICF is the leading global organization for coaching certification and sets the standards for the coaching profession. The ICF offers three levels of coaching certification: Associate Certified Coach (ACC), Professional Certified Coach (PCC), and Master Certified Coach (MCC). The ICF also provides a Code of Ethics and a set of Core Competencies that all certified coaches must adhere to.

Strategies for Effective Coaching

As a coach, your role is to help your clients achieve their goals and make progress towards their desired outcomes. To do this, you need to employ various strategies that foster growth and motivation. Here are some key strategies for effective coaching:

Goal-Setting Techniques

Setting realistic goals is an essential part of coaching. Encourage your clients to set specific, measurable, achievable, relevant, and time-bound (SMART) goals. Make sure the goals are challenging but also achievable, and help your clients break them down into smaller, more manageable steps. By setting clear goals, your clients can stay motivated and focused on their desired outcomes.

Developing Resilience and Encouragement

Resilience is the ability to bounce back from setbacks and challenges. As a coach, you need to help your clients develop resilience so they can overcome obstacles and stay motivated. Encourage your clients to adopt a growth mindset, focus on their strengths, and learn from their mistakes. Provide encouragement and support, and help your clients build their self-confidence.

Action Plans and Accountability

An action plan is a roadmap that outlines the steps your clients need to take to achieve their goals. Encourage your clients to create an action plan that includes specific tasks, deadlines, and milestones. Hold your clients accountable for their progress and help them stay on track. Regular check-ins can help your clients stay motivated and focused on their goals.

Challenges in Coaching

Coaching is a rewarding profession, but it also comes with its own set of challenges. As a coach, you may encounter various problems while trying to motivate your clients. In this section, we will discuss some of the most common challenges in coaching and how to overcome them.

Overcoming Barriers to Motivation

One of the biggest challenges in coaching is overcoming barriers to motivation. Your clients may lack motivation due to various reasons, such as fear of failure, lack of confidence, or a negative mindset. As a coach, it is your job to help your clients overcome these barriers and find their motivation.

To overcome barriers to motivation, you can use various techniques, such as goal setting, positive reinforcement, and visualization. By setting clear goals, you can help your clients focus on their objectives and stay motivated. Positive reinforcement, such as praise and recognition, can also help boost your clients' motivation. Visualization techniques, such as guided imagery, can help your clients visualize their success and stay motivated.

Addressing Demotivation and Procrastination

Another challenge in coaching is addressing demotivation and procrastination. Your clients may become demotivated or procrastinate due to various reasons, such as lack of interest, burnout, or overwhelming workload. As a coach, it is your job to help your clients address these issues and stay on track.

To address demotivation and procrastination, you can use various techniques, such as time management, stress management, and self-care. By helping your clients manage their time effectively, you can help them prioritize their tasks and stay on track. Stress management techniques, such as meditation and deep breathing, can also help your clients stay calm and focused. Self-care techniques, such as exercise and healthy eating, can help your clients maintain their energy and motivation.

Customizing Approaches for Individual Needs

Finally, one of the biggest challenges in coaching is customizing your approach to meet the individual needs of your clients. Every client is unique, and what works for one client may not work for another. As a coach, it is your job to tailor your approach to meet the individual needs of each client.

To customize your approach, you can use various techniques, such as active listening, empathy, and flexibility. By actively listening to your clients, you can gain a better understanding of their needs and preferences. Empathy can help you connect with your clients on a deeper level and understand their emotions. Flexibility can help you adapt your approach to meet the changing needs of your clients.
